A Power BI course prepares individuals with the skills to use Microsoft Power BI, a leading business intelligence and data visualization tool. The course teaches participants how to analyze and visualize data, create dynamic reports and dashboards, and extract actionable insights for business decision-making.
Our expert trainers help the participants learn various topics in the Power BI training. Some of the topics that are covered are:
1) Data Modeling
2) Report Creation
3) Dashboard Development
4) DAX
5) Power Query
6) Data Visualization Techniques
